Unit Information
The NASA Bay Young Marines unit is one of over 350 units belonging to the National Young Marine Program. Started in 1958, the Young Marine program is one that endeavors to instill positive values and a drug free lifestyle in today's boys and girls, aged 8 to 18. Throughout our Nation, there are more than 14,000 young Americans being guided by an organization based on Marines giving back to their communities.

There are currently 13 Young Marine units in the State of Texas. The NASA Bay Young Marines unit, like other Young Marine units is not a funded organization and relies on the hard work of the Young Marines through fundraising efforts and the benevolence of the business community and service organizations. The adult staff, primarily former Marines, Active Duty Marines, and former military is all volunteer and is composed of members within our community.

Recruit Training
Upon joining The NASA Bay Young Marine unit, the youth undergo a Recruit Training (Boot Camp) which is conducted every Saturday from 0900 to 1530 (9:00 am until 3:30 pm) for 8-13 weeks. The youth learn general subjects such as history, customs and courtesies, close order drill, physical fitness, and military rank structure. Recruit training culminates with a two day recruit challenge (camping trip) where the recruits put into practice the skills they have learned. Upon completion of recruit training, a graduation ceremony is held (on the 8th or 13th Sat.) and the recruits officially become Young Marines. After Recruit Training
After graduating from recruit training, the youth meet as Young Marines every other Saturday from 0900 - 1530 (there are sometimes changes to this schedule). They also have the opportunity to learn more new skills, earn rank, wear the Young Marine uniform and work toward ribbon awards. Young Marines earn ribbons for achievement in areas such as leadership, community service, swimming, academic excellence, first aid and drug resistance education.
